C#で文字列が空でもNullでもない時だけを判別する if (String.IsNullOrEmpty(str) == false) { Console.Error.WriteLine(str); } 高瀬 裕介ハック2016.04.12 1,229
C# で外部プロセスをパイプしたい時 コマンドプロンプトで実行する場合 netstat -an | find /c /v “” C# で実行する場合 ProcessStartInfo psInfo1 = new ProcessStartInfo(); psI… 高瀬 裕介ハック2016.04.08 4,641
.Net Framework + C#のコンソールアプリでDebugの時はコンソールが閉じないようにする #if DEBUG Console.WriteLine(“続行するには何かキーを押してください...”); Console.ReadKey(); #endif 高瀬 裕介ハック2016.04.05 515
C#でインスタンスを保存・読込する 保存したいインスタンスのクラスは、次のように宣言する。 [Serializable]class TestClass { 〜略〜 } 次のような処理で保存・読込することが出来る //保存したいクラスを宣言 TestCl… otaguroハック2015.10.30 2,430
.NET版Sheets APIで各行の特定のセルを操作 以下は各行の「予定日」を取得して今日よりも前であればコンソール出力する例です。 foreach (ListEntry row in listFeed.Entries) { foreach (ListEntry.Custo… Tetsuro Aokiハック2015.10.23 192
C#でWindows Updateを1ずつインストールするメソッド IUpdateCollectionからまとめて実行するのが主流かと思いますが1つずつ実行したかったので作ってみました。 ダウンロードかインストールに失敗するとコンソール出力してfalseを返します。 using WUAp… Tetsuro Aokiハック2015.10.16 1,746
C#でgoogle spreadsheetのgidをworksheetIdに変換する public string long36ToString(long num) { string char36 = “0123456789abcdefghijklmnopqrstuvwxyz”; string conver… Tetsuro Aokiハック2015.10.13 498
.NET版Sheets APIでセルを取得 /* OAuth認証を終え、変数serviceにSpreadsheetsServiceが入っているものとします */ // get sheet string sheetUrl = “https://spreadsheet… Tetsuro Aokiハック2015.10.09 675
.NET版Sheets APIでシートをIDから取得 SpreadsheetQueryのコンストラクタ引数にシートIDを含んだURLを渡すことで可能です。 string url = “https://spreadsheets.google.com/feeds/spreads… Tetsuro Aokiハック2015.10.06 578